Dear xserver maintainer,

I am runing Debian Jessie on my notebook and using fglrx-driver to enable xserver (otherwise it didn't work). During apt upgrade on 13th October this driver has been removed. After rebooting xserver refused to start because unknown "fglrx" module in xorg.conf. So I removed my xorg.conf and executed "Xorg -configure". But that resulted in a segfault.

I have attached Xorg.0.log with backtrace.

Maybe it helps if I tell you that I have reported this bug #699345 before I have installed fglrx driver.

My videocard: AMD/ATI Radeon HD 6480G
